The Role of Game Mechanics and Thematic Innovation
Modern online slots are no longer simple spinning reels; they incorporate complex game mechanics such as cascading reels, expanding wilds, and multi-level bonus rounds. Thematic richness further elevates engagement, with popular titles often drawing inspiration from adventurous themes, movies, or folklore. These elements are crafted to evoke emotional connections, fostering longer play sessions and higher retention rates.
Emerging Technologies Shaping the Future
Key technological trends—including HTML5 development, augmented reality (AR), and blockchain integration—are shaping the future of online slots. HTML5 has become the industry standard, ensuring cross-platform compatibility and smoother user experiences. AR introduces immersive environments that can blend real-world settings with game graphics, while blockchain enhances transparency and security, building trust among players and operators alike.
